Improvisation / Composition Workshop with Kara Davis (Project Agora)
$45 per day / early registration $55 per day / walk up rate * The workshop is limited to 12 attendees per day. Email or call Kara Davis to secure your space: projectagora.kcd@gmail.com / (415)-509-2124 This workshop is open to dancers and musicians interested in exploring various improvisation modalities in order to enhance collaboration, connection, and understanding. Exercises given are applicable and interchangeable to both genres of expression. Each day will begin with a shared hour-long guided improvisation warm up. Dancers and musicians will respond to various prompts intended to heighten their states of observation, disrupt habitual tendencies to allow new creativity to emerge, and to more deeply connect with one another as artistic collaborators mutually shaping time and space. Afterwards, participants will engage in various structured improvisation exercises designed to enhance compositional awareness and deepen receptivity to one another. Participants who attend all four days are of the workshop areinvited to perform an improvisation at The Garage on Thursday, August 23, 8 pm. |

COLLABORATION & CREATION with Phoebe Osborn (US) / Joana Serra (Spain) / Ursa Sekirnik (Slovenia) / Andrea Vicente (Spain) This workshop introduces methods of collaborative creation that have been developed by artists Ursa Sekirnik (Slovenia), Joana Serra (Spain), Andrea Vicente (Spain), and Phoebe Osborne (USA/Spain). These female artists have developed ways of practicing collaboration as the cornerstone approach to their improvisation, choreography, and performance. The workshop introduces their methods of creative process and facilitates dialogue about non-hierarchical collaborative creation. |
